The Shining Sea Bikeway is rated by some as one of the Ten Best Bike Trails in the world!  Lined with familiar Cape Cod flower and tree species, it makes for a wonderful ride from Falmouth to scenic Woods Hole. Following the Old Colony rail line, the newer extension passes through Sippewissett Marsh, by cranberry bogs and overlooks Chapaquoit Beach. The route winds along the coastline and crisscrosses the Salt Pond Bird Sanctuary.
